How opaque glass works.

Opaque and frosted glass scatter light as it passes through the surface. Instead of travelling in a straight line, light is diffused in multiple directions, creating a soft glow rather than clear visibility.

Opaque glass vs frosted window film.

Opaque glass can be created in two main ways:

  • permanently etched or sandblasted glass

  • applied privacy window film

Privacy window film is often the more flexible and cost-effective option. It can be installed onto existing glazing and achieves a similar frosted appearance without replacing the glass.

Choosing the right level of opacity.

Not all opaque finishes are the same. Some provide full privacy at all times, while others offer partial visibility depending on lighting conditions.

Factors to consider include:

  • required privacy level

  • lighting conditions

  • glass size and position

  • residential or commercial use

Solar Control for The Glasshouse Hotel

Location: Edinburgh, Scotland

Goal: The project aimed to reduce heat build-up caused by extensive glazing. Solar control film was specified to improve comfort without altering the appearance.

Results:

  • Installed solar control film to over 300 panes of glazing.
  • Reduced heat gain, glare, and UV transmission.
  • Completed phased internal installation with minimal disruption.

This project demonstrates how solar control window film can effectively manage heat gain in large glazed spaces. Comfort is improved without compromising views or aesthetics.
